Employee Benefits
The City of Grand Rapids has over 1,800 employees delivering services to its citizens. The employment turnover rate is one of the lowest found with any employer. Part of the reason for that low turnover is the excellent benefit package listed below. In addition, the City has a team-oriented work force dedicated to customer service. The family values of the community are reflected in the values of the work force, making the work place very much an extension of the family. Benefits include, but are not limited to, the following:
- Competitive Salaries
- Comprehensive Health Care package, including prescription drug, dental, and vision coverage

- Generous Vacation Plan
- Paid Holidays
- Paid Sick Leave
- Longevity Pay
- Paid Jury Duty
- Bereavement Leave
- Defined Benefit Pension Plan
- Cash Death Benefit
- Direct Deposit of paychecks
Voluntary Benefits:
- Professional Development Funding
- Tax Deferred Compensation (457 Plan)
- Section 125
- Cafeteria Style benefits, including Life, Disability, and Cancer
- Flexible Spending Accounts (FSA) - Medical and Dependent Care Reimbursements
- Employee Assistance Program
- Home Ownership Grant in Target Areas
- Michigan Education Savings Program (Tuition Savings Program)
- Ability to join the Grand Rapids Family Credit Union
